Runbook: Metaclean EXIF scrubber (Brindle cluster). If scrubbed images start retaining GPS tags, first verify the worker pool is reading the correct environment. The scrubber will silently pass through files when its queue credential is missing, which is dangerous. Recreate the env file carefully: after the queue host setting, the next line must be the following.

sealed setting: RELAY_SECRET29=2d90f50448baa6c07af134de232e6

Several customers on the Harborline deployment report that the TilePull map-tile prefetcher fails signature checks on bundles published after Tuesday's rotation. The verifier still holds the retired key, so every download is quarantined and the cache goes stale. Workaround: clear the quarantine directory, then replace the pinned verification key in the prefetcher config and restart the service. Confirm the fingerprint with the customer before applying. The current valid key for verification follows.

signing key of bagap-yawep = bky13_TbfT6ZMUoGJo2

**Q3 Planning Note — Retail Pilot**

To all heads of department: the pilot with Harrowgate Mercantile is confirmed for twelve stores in the Velden district, running ten weeks from the start of Q3. Our Shelfwise inventory module will be deployed alongside their existing tills, with Priya Oswin's team handling integration and on-site training. Success metrics are shrinkage reduction and restock cycle time. Weekly readouts go to the steering group; department resourcing asks are due by Friday. The broader commercial intent is set out below.

internal memo for fahif-bawip: Headcount on the Ralael team goes from 48 to 96 by the end of December. Gross margin on Ralael came in at 14 percent against a plan of 3 percent.

**Ticket: Config drift on TallyCore ledger nodes**

Priority: High. Two TallyCore production nodes are running stale settlement settings after last week's hotfix. Symptom: points balances lag by up to an hour for customers routed to node B. Do not restart nodes manually; drift repair is scheduled tonight. For reference when handling tickets, the correct production configuration is as follows.

config for kafof-bawef:
holath:
  log_level: debug
  metrics_host: metrics.holath.qorvelsys.internal
  pin: 2191
  pool_size: 32